Steve
Chaconas brings 25 years of bass fishing experience on the Potomac River
to columns featured in the Sportsman's Magazine, Woods & Waters,
and The Old Town Crier. He has also written for the Free Lance
Star newspaper, The Mount Vernon Gazette, The Mount Vernon Voice, The
American Sportfishing Association and many others. Steve also hosted the
National Bass Fishing Radio Show.
A
U.S. Coast Guard Captain, licensed by the Potomac River Fisheries Commission
and the Maryland Department of Natural Resources, Steve has the opportunity
to fish with anglers of all skill levels, including some of the biggest
names in pro bass fishing.
Steve's been featured in local and national newspapers, magazines and
on TV and radio: BASSMASTERS, BASS TIMES, BASSIN' Magazine, BoatUS
Magazine, The Washington Post, The Washington Times, The Los Angeles
Times, ESPN and others. He's been: emcee of the St. Jude Children's Hospital
Tournament the past 11 years, a member of Boat US Speakers Bureau, the
Southeastern Outdoor Press Association and a member of the American Sportfishing
Association. Steve has been awarded an Excellence in Craft award from
SEOPA and was the recipient of the Mount Vernon Lee Chamber of Commerce
2002 and 2003 Home-Based Business of the Year Award.
Prior
to fishing, Steve's careers included teaching high school algebra and
sales of cars, computers and surgical products. He also hosted the longest
running all-financial morning radio show in the country and is considered
to be "The Father of Business Radio".
